Block Wall Installation in Boston, MA
Block wall installation services involve constructing durable, sturdy walls using concrete blocks, often for purposes such as property boundary marking, privacy enhancement, or decorative landscaping features. These projects can range from simple garden enclosures to more complex retaining walls that manage soil and water flow on a property. Homeowners typically seek this service to improve security, define outdoor spaces, or add aesthetic value to their landscape, making it important to understand the materials used, the structural requirements, and how the wall will integrate with existing property features before requesting an installation.
Property owners should consider factors such as the intended purpose of the wall, the size and location of the project, and any local building codes or regulations that might apply. It’s also useful to clarify the desired appearance, whether a traditional concrete block look or a more decorative finish, and to understand the necessary preparation work, such as foundation excavation or drainage considerations. Having a clear idea of these details can help ensure the project aligns with the property’s needs and expectations.

Block Wall Installation Questions
What types of projects are suitable for block wall installation? Block walls are commonly used for garden borders, retaining walls, privacy enclosures, and boundary definitions around residential and commercial properties.
What materials are typically used for block walls? Concrete blocks, cinder blocks, and decorative concrete masonry units are popular choices for durability and aesthetic appeal.
How long does a block wall installation usually take? Installation duration varies based on project size and complexity, but it generally ranges from a few days to a week for standard projects.
What should property owners consider before installing a block wall? Factors include the purpose of the wall, property layout, local regulations, and the type of soil and terrain where the wall will be built.
